From: Half-metallic carbon nitride nanosheets with micro grid mode resonance structure for efficient photocatalytic hydrogen evolution

Electronic structure of hm-C(CN)3 nanosheets. a Photograph of the hm-C(CN)3 nanosheet film patterned with the Au line for the scanning Kelvin probe measurement. b Line-scan data show the Fermi level of hm-C(CN)3 at each position on the purple line in a. c Band structure for hm-C(CN)3. The position of the reduction level for H+ to H2 is indicated by the dashed blue line and the oxidation potential of H2O to O2 is indicated by the purple dashed line just above the valence band. The blue and pink arrows represent the CB and VB positions of hm-C(CN)3 nanosheets which acquired from the experiment. d Spin-resolved total density of state for hm-C(CN)3. The short pink dotted line indicates the Fermi level
